What to look for in Heat Exchanger Replacement in Bowling Green
The heat exchanger is the part most often falsely condemned to sell a new furnace, because homeowners can't see it. The work worth paying for documents a suspected crack with a measured CO reading and a camera before recommending replacement, and checks the manufacturer warranty first. We weight documented-diagnosis and warranty handling over a condemn-on-sight upsell.
- Documented-diagnosis method. Provider states it proves a crack with a combustion analyzer (CO reading) plus a camera or visual inspection before condemning — not a 'looks cracked' call.
- Manufacturer authorization. Factory-authorized status handles in-warranty heat-exchanger claims, which turns a full replacement into a labor-only bill.
- Google rating. A strong rating floor matters on a high-cost, high-trust safety repair.
Verify before you book
- Whether a specific crack was real — ask to see the CO reading and the inspection-camera image.
- Your part's actual warranty status — confirm coverage with the manufacturer before approving the work.
- License status with your state board — verify TDLR (TX), ROC (AZ), or your local equivalent before paying.

What Bowling Green homeowners ask most about hiring a Furnace Repair pro
- Is a cracked heat exchanger really dangerous, or a sales tactic?
- Both can be true. A genuine crack can leak carbon monoxide, so it's a real safety issue — but it's also the part most often falsely condemned to sell a new furnace, because homeowners can't see it. Insist on proof: a measured CO reading from a combustion analyzer plus a camera or visual inspection before you accept a replacement.
- Should I replace the heat exchanger or the whole furnace?
- It hinges on warranty and age. If the heat exchanger is still under the manufacturer's (often 20-year or lifetime) warranty, you usually pay labor only. Out of warranty on an older furnace, a full part-plus-labor replacement often approaches the cost of a new unit, so an honest shop quotes both paths.
- How do homeowners know when a heat-exchanger replacement is necessary in Bowling Green?
- Visible cracks on inspection, persistent combustion smells, or repeated limit trips suggest a problematic heat exchanger. A certified technician should perform a combustion and leak test. Because older homes in Bowling Green often have legacy furnace models, ask for documentation of inspection findings and for a written explanation of why replacement, rather than repair, is recommended.
- What should a homeowner ask about gas-furnace combustion testing in Bowling Green?
- Ask whether the contractor performs combustion-analysis testing and provides printed results. Testing should include CO and draft measurements and check venting for code compliance. Confirm the technician's experience with gas-furnace combustion diagnostics and request that the provider note any corrective steps required to meet safety standards under Kentucky DHBC guidance.
